- Management support and consensus. It is essential that all stakeholders, particularly business leadership, agree on the goals for the project and are supportive of the work throughout the process. Everyone must understand and agree on what is to be accomplished. There must be a common vision, not just for the scope of the project, but how success will be judged at the end.
- A powerful plan. A thorough plan that has clearly defined roles and responsibilities is also critical. The plan is used to manage and monitor the project's performance throughout the process. The real key is the ability to use that plan to manage progress and communicate effectively as the project progresses.
- Effective communication. This means opening the loop between the project manager and the project team, between all team members, and among the project manager and the organization's leadership and other internal and external stakeholders. The communication must be multidirectional, and be effective, whether written, verbal or nonverbal. While actions speak louder than words, communication is key to knowing what those actions should be and when they should be completed.
- Scope control. Scope changes are inevitable and will alter a project's scope. Need to control the scope as much as possible. All involved with the project must understand that a change in scope has implications on the project's cost, schedule and the quality of the end product.
- Consistent methodology. This stems from the ability to leverage the knowledge gained from prior projects. Prior practice creates a consistent terminology and provides experiences to draw from. Creating consistency allows project managers to better set and manage stakeholder expectations, since they'll be more comfortable as to what should be happening throughout the process.
